With finance taking on a bigger role in guiding and executing on corporate strategy, CFOs are looking for ways to make sure their organisations are actually ready for the job. After all, many finance organisations were built to serve a different purpose – one focused more on transactional and administrative tasks. But today, finance needs to gather, interpret and deliver insights that can shape smarter decision making in the C-Suite.
